Position Summary

Odyssey Systems has an exciting opportunity for a Data Links and Communication Engineer SME to provide technical support to the Air Force Life Cycle Management Center (AFLCMC), Aerial Networks Division (AFLCMC/HNA) in support of the Tactical Data Networks Enterprise Program.

The selected candidate will bring deep subject matter expertise in the design, testing, deployment, and sustainment of tactical communications systems and data links, supporting multiple Air Force and Joint mission sets. This is a full-time onsite position located at Hanscom AFB, Bedford, MA.

Responsibilities

In this Advisory and Assistance Services (A&AS) role, you will provide expert-level support to Department of Defense (DoD) programs by assisting government leadership with decision-making, planning, and execution throughout the acquisition lifecycle. You will apply your technical and/or professional expertise to ensure compliance with applicable policies and regulations, contribute to mission success, and help deliver critical capabilities to the warfighter.

Duties include, but not limited to:

  • Support the development, integration, testing, and deployment of USAF systems and their associated data links.
  • Define data link interoperability requirements, interface specifications, and verification/test assessment strategies.
  • Collaborate with USAF, DoD, Army, Joint, and federal agencies to ensure communications compliance with FAA, DISA, NSA, JMPS, and other technical and business standards.
  • Provide support and interface with stakeholders such as ACC, AFC2IC, JITC, and SPAWAR for C3 infrastructure and key distribution issues.
  • Advise and assist Engineers, IPTs, PMs, and Joint Test Teams on planning, performance, schedule, and cost issues related to communications and control.
  • Provide subject matter expertise in the following areas:
    • Tactical Platform Open Mission Systems (OMS):
      Architectures, processing environments, and integration into CCWG/OCS reference models.
    • Enterprise Communications:
      Support integration efforts (e.g., DARPA DyNAMO, Combat Cloud) and contribute to IERs, platform GIG requirements.
    • Beyond Line of Sight (BLOS) Waveforms: AEHF/WGS, PTW, Iridium/Inmarsat; advise on infrastructure dependencies and operational integration.
    • J-Series & UCI Protocols:
      Develop and support schema, IERs, ICDs, and DoDAF architecture products.
    • JMPS Liaison & Communications Planning:
      Advise on mission planning and contribute to communications requirements for tactical platforms.
    • Agile Communications Initiatives:
      Engage in dynamic and innovative communication architecture strategies across joint platforms.
  • Lead or support the following mission areas:
    • Combat Net Radio (CNR):
      Define networking parameters for flexible, cross-platform CNR integration.
    • Test & Demonstration:
      Provide engineering support for interoperability testing using UHF CNR and Link 16 with Threshold/Objective platforms.
    • Joint Concept of Employment (CONEMP):
      Develop and present Joint CONEMPs for LINK-16/UHF CNR compatible environments.
    • Cryptologic Systems:
      Design joint COMSEC strategies for cryptologic data dissemination to weapons/controllers.
    • Link 16 Networking:
      Support tactical data link integration strategies and minimize operational disruption for existing users.
    • Interface Control:
      Document and manage Link-16 J11.X messaging within Joint CM frameworks for interoperability and system evolution.
    • Implementation:
      Define specs for interoperability across air/ground launch and control systems (e.g., F-15E, F-35, TACP, TLDS).
